Maybe if he gets hired again this time he'll have a finisher he can actually do properly more than 1 time out of 10. Ever since seeing him in wcw he never seems to hit that shooting star press properly, always seems to end up at some akward angle which mean his legs have a habit of getting close to his oponents head. Probably to do with the way he does the move, he sorta just hops off the turnbuckle whereas with london its a larger jump so he can get the rotation higher off the ground and land properly.

I like Billy Kidman. His match with Jamie Noble at Survivor Series 2002 is probably one of the better cruiserweight matches in WWE history. His WWE Tag Team Title Match with Rey Mysterio against The World's Greatest Tag Team at Vengeance 2003 was awesome as well. Plus he had that run with Paul London, even if they didn't get to finish their feud.

I think they're bringing him back because they need a babyface opponent for Gregory Helms. I'd just bring in Jimmy Yang, but hey, what do I know? Billy Kidman is a pretty good worker, but I think he'll work better as a tag team guy or a RAW mid-carder at this point of his career. He's going to be working a lot slower.
